Why Calm Can’t Be Forced
The major task of the brain is not peacefulness but survival.
Once the nervous system perceives danger or real danger the brain switches to protective responses, such as, fight, flight, or freeze. Self-talk in these states, in terms of saying, relax, hardly works. The rational mind is not able to take a backseat because the body thinks it must be on the alert.
This is one of the reasons why most human beings are irritated by conventional methods of relaxation. The issue isn’t motivation. It’s biology.
Several predictable, rhythmic, and non-threatening sensory inputs to the brain, which convey a signal of safety at the nervous-system level, result in the emergence of calm.
That is where relaxing tools may be helpful.

FAQs
What is a calming device?
A calming device is a tool designed to support nervous system regulation by providing predictable sensory input, such as light, sound, or vibration, helping the brain shift out of constant alertness and into a calmer state.
Do calming devices actually work for stress and anxiety?
Calming devices can be supportive for stress and anxiety when they work with the nervous system rather than trying to suppress symptoms. Their effectiveness depends on how well they align with natural brain and sensory processing.
How does a calming device affect the brain?
Many calming devices influence brain activity through rhythm and repetition, which can help the brain move toward more regulated brainwave patterns associated with relaxation, focus, or rest.
Is a calming device the same as medication?
No. A calming device does not alter brain chemistry like medication. Instead, it offers sensory signals that help the nervous system feel safe enough to settle naturally.
